Bridgerton clothes



The dresses in Bridgerton are inspired from the Regency era with using a modern flair, they often are very bright colorful clothes that are both solid colored and also patterned.
 

The silhouettes are elegant usually with a square neckline, an empire waist, and a floor-legnthed skirt.

The details are puffed sleves as well as capped sleves. The fabrics are usually silk and lace, with various colors and patterns. The men wear well-tailored suits, waistcoats, and various accesseories that are practical and show their status. The suits have clean lines, precise collars, with small buttons. The waistcoats are often blue or turquoise, with many details. And they also wore suspenders and cravats (a short scarf necktie that is worn around the neck and tcuked into their shirt collar)
